  1. 2.  Major Nathaniel JENCKS was born on 29 Jan 1662/3 in Providence, Rhode Island; died on 11 Aug 1723 in Providence, Rhode Island.

    Notes:

    Name:
    The Massachusetts Society of Mayflower Descendants has Nathaniel's Bible that begins "Nathanael Jenckes his Bible Bought 1720." It records the births of himself, his wife, and their four children. The Bible then passed to his grandson Stephen.

    Nathaniel Jencks was made a freeman in 1690. He served as a deputy in 1709, 1710, and 1713. He served on the town council from 1719 to 1723.

    The 'Bosworth Gen' quotes a manuscript that says Nathaniel Jencks "was famous for strength in many ways and at different exercises. he lifted the great Forge Hammer of 500 pounds weight, together with seven men thereon, and the handle thereof; one man whereof lifted up under the drone beam with all his might to react against him; a proof of great, very great strength indeed. he was very active in the defense of the Town against the Indians."

    Nathaniel Jencks was a Captain and later a Major.

    On 26 March 1719 Nathaniel Jenckes of Providence in consideration of the well settlement of his son Jonathan Jenckes of Scituate, gave him 1/2 of 300 acres that Nathaniel and "his brother William have in Providence."

    The will of Nathaniel Jenckes of Providence dated 27 April 1721, codicil 31 July 1723, proved 31 October 1723....

    Nathaniel married Hannah BOSWORTH on 4 Nov 1686 in Swansea, Bristol Co., Massachusetts. Hannah (daughter of Jonathan BOSWORTH and Hannah HOWLAND) was born on 05 Nov 1663 in Swansea, Bristol County, Massachusetts; died after 31 Jul 1723. [Group Sheet] [Family Chart]
